The Robin Theatre in Lansing, Mich., has added a bookstore called Robin Books, the Lansing City Pulse reported. The small general-interest store offers a curated selection of new and used titles, from literary fiction and nonfiction to plays and mythology, as well as gifts.
The bookstore will soon start "testing," with indoor shopping hours scheduled for every Saturday in October. Customers can also shop by appointment, and Robin Books is now accepting donations of gently used books.
Owners Dylan Rogers and Jeana-Dee Allen, who founded the Robin Theatre in Lansing's REO Town in 2015, said they were inspired to start a bookstore on a trip to Bogota, Colombia, where they visited a "magical bookstore."
Rogers added that they're reaching out to local authors to plan readings and signings, and working toward establishing consistent hours. "I want to build something that is charming, interesting and valuable to the community."
